About This Color

PANTONE 94-5-4 U is a moderately saturated cyan with dark tonality. Its HEX value is #185F70, placing it in the cyan region of the color spectrum with a hue angle of 192°.

This darker shade conveys depth and authority, making it ideal for premium branding, typographic elements, and high-contrast design compositions.
